Most elite players will produce no matter who they're with. You'll see minor drops in points but it won't be significant. The most influential things on production are ice time, PP ice time and how good your teams PP is.

Datsyuk had 49 points in 47 games playing mostly with Dan Cleary who had 15 points and Justin Abdelkader who had 13 points in the lockout season.
